EagleRider Introduces Pillion Tour Program for Non-Riders

Motorcycle tour operator EagleRider is launching a new program for non-riders. Celebrating its 20th anniversary this year, EagleRider offers motorcycle rentals and guided motorcycle tours. Until now however, you had to have a motorcycle license or ride as a passenger with another traveler who does.

The new Pillion Ride & Day Tours programs puts people on the passenger seat behind Motorcycle Safety Foundation certified tour guides who will show them the sights. As of now, the Pillion Ride & Day Tours are only offered from EagleRider’s Florida locations but the company plans to offer the program to other locations in the future.

“For 20 years, EagleRider has been dedicated to helping our customers live the dream, giving them the ultimate thrill of riding with the wind in their hair,” says Chris McIntyre, EagleRider co-founder and president. “This program is perfect for non-riders whether they be cruise travelers looking for a new excursion at port, island hoppers wanting to seek new roads or thrill seekers thirsting to burn a little rubber. We want motorcycle riding to be accessible for everyone.”

Packages begin at $359 a person which includes the tour guide, a choice of Harley-Davidson, BMW, Honda or Triumph motorcycles, fuel and oil, helmet and jacket rental, an orientation session, lunch, discounted activities during the tour as well as a souvenir t-shirt and photograph.
